Bicentennial Steering Committee apologizes to Religious Community, political parties……

MONROVIA, LIBERIA-The National Steering Committee of the Bi-centennial celebrations has apologized to the Religious Community and political parties for not inviting them to the official kickoff event at the Providence Island.

The apology was issued Wednesday, January 12, 2022, by the National Steering Committee, through its Chairman, Information Minister Ledgerhood Rennie.

Minister Rennie attributed the Committee’s inability to invite the two groups to oversight by the protocol, which was not intentional.

Minister Rennie said going forward; the two groups will not only be given invitations, but a role to play, especially for the Religious Community.

According to him, the Two-hundredth Anniversary of the establishment of the Liberian State is inclusive of all Liberians, regardless of affiliations.

Minister Rennie also said:” Preparations for the February 14, 2022 launch of the program are ongoing to host foreign guests, including Heads of State.”
